Air as a Progressive Spring
Conventional coil springs provide a linear resistance to compression; the extra they’re compressed, the larger the power they exert. This will result in a harsh trip, notably when encountering bigger bumps. Air, nonetheless, behaves otherwise. Because the suspension compresses, the air quantity decreases, and the stress will increase, making a progressive spring charge. Which means the preliminary response to smaller bumps is gentle and compliant, whereas the resistance will increase considerably when encountering bigger obstacles. This adaptive conduct is essential in sustaining a easy trip high quality throughout quite a lot of highway surfaces.

Query 2: Can any generic air compressor be used to service the system?
The attract of a available and cheap generic air compressor is comprehensible. Nevertheless, the system operates inside a particular stress vary and requires a compressor able to delivering constant, regulated stress. Utilizing an incompatible compressor can result in over-inflation, probably damaging seals and different vital parts. Adherence to producer specs is paramount.
Query 3: What constitutes “correct” air stress for this technique?
A common “one measurement matches all” stress setting doesn’t exist. Optimum stress is contingent upon a number of elements, together with rider weight, passenger presence, and cargo load. Consulting the proprietor’s handbook for really useful stress ranges primarily based on these variables is important. Failing to take action may end up in compromised dealing with, decreased consolation, and potential suspension injury.

Query 5: How continuously ought to the air trip system be inspected and serviced?
Neglecting routine upkeep is akin to inviting future problems. Common inspections, together with checks for leaks, worn hoses, and correct compressor operation, are important. The frequency of those inspections is dependent upon utilization, however a normal guideline is to examine the system no less than each 5,000 miles or yearly, whichever comes first. Proactive upkeep is considerably cheaper than reactive repairs.
